How tall is a gallon jar?

Gallon Wide Mouth Jars 110-400 Finish

Jar Volume 128 oz
Height 9.95 inches
Outside Diameter 6.1 inches
Label Panel Height 6.22 inches
Circumference 19.25 inches

How do you sterilize a 1 gallon glass jug?

How To Sterilise Jars

  1. Step 1: Wash the jars thoroughly in hot soapy water, rinse then dry.
  2. Step 2: Place on an oven rack with equal spacing, heat them to 120° for 15 minutes.
  3. Step 3: Place the glass jars in the dishwasher on a hot cycle.
  4. Step 4: Sterilise the metal seals in boiling water for 5 minutes then leave to dry.

How do you clean the inside of a glass water jug?

Pour a little vinegar and water inside the bottle, cork it and shake well: if you think it is necessary, repeat the operation maybe also adding a little lemon juice. For an even better result, let the mixture work in the bottle for the whole night, then shake it again, rinse well and put the bottles to dry.
